Orlando, FL 32818. 8 a.m. to 5 p.m.Sep 11, 2023 · Mix your old gas with new gas in a 1:3 ratio. The best way to make old gas usable is to dilute it with new gas. Simply fill your car’s fuel tank or a storage tank with 3 gallons (11 l) of fresh gas for every 1 gallon (3 l) of old gas you pour in. Then, gently rock your car or shake the storage tank to mix the gas together. Nov 20, 2023 · Step-by-Step Guide To Disposing Of Gasoline. Almost all Missourians use household products that have the potential to be hazardous. Ordinary products such as cleaning products, batteries, light bulbs, paint, pesticides and motor oil can be harmful and potentially dangerous if disposed incorrectly. Some products may cause fires or contaminate our soil, groundwater, lakes and streams.
